Output 61c02025e2d07a442ccb1da591bf27080bfe253c0eafabfee4ea9d8a8b69b9f5:52

value
10532805
script pubkey
OP_0 OP_PUSHBYTES_20 17398ca8cbcc68493b9af7cb0b531d90d51ced8a
address
bc1qzuuce2xte35yjwu67l9sk5cajr23emv2s5apmx
transaction
61c02025e2d07a442ccb1da591bf27080bfe253c0eafabfee4ea9d8a8b69b9f5
spent
true